Call the Chicago Zoning board of appeals and ask them directly why it is rejected and what can you do to make it accepted as a 3 unit.https://www.chicago.gov/city/e...If they tell you that there is a specific requirement you need satisfy then do it. if they tell you there is nothing you can do unless you request a re-zoning then consider whether you want to spend the money and time going through the rezoning process or accept it as is or reject the deal.
